Turbo Express

7777 East Apache Street # 2201B, Tulsa
Phone: +1 918-938-6408

Categories: Establishment  Moving company 

Suggest updates

Reviews

Sorry, we haven't any reviews about company Turbo Express.

Write a review

The nearest companies